tush 1

 (tŭsh)
interj.
Used to express mild reproof, disapproval, or admonition.

tush 2

 (tŭsh)
n.
A canine tooth, especially of a horse.

[Middle English tusche, from Old English tūsc; see tusk.]

tush 3

 (to͝osh)
n. Slang
The buttocks.

[Alteration of Yiddish tokhes, from Hebrew taḥat, under, buttocks; see tḥt in Semitic roots.]
